Ionic Bond

The electrostatic force that holds ions together in an ionic compound.

Covalent Bond

A bond in which two electrons are shared by two atoms.

Lattice Energy

The energy required to completely separate one mole of a solid ionic compound into gaseous ions.

Electronegativity

The ability of an atom to attract toward itself the electrons in a chemical bond.

Lewis Structure

A diagram that shows the arrangement of valence electrons among atoms in a molecule.

Formal Charge

The charge an atom would have if all atoms in the molecule had the same electronegativity.

Bond Enthalpy

The enthalpy change required to break a particular bond in 1 mole of gaseous molecules.

Octet Rule

An atom tends to form bonds until it is surrounded by eight valence electrons.

Resonance Structure

One of two or more Lewis structures for a single molecule that cannot be represented accurately by only one structure.

Polar Covalent Bond

Electrons are shared unequally between two atoms.
